Arnold Bennett (18671931) was a British novelist, journalist, and playwright known for his keen observations of everyday life. His works, including The Old Wives' Tale and the Clayhanger series, vividly depict the struggles and aspirations of the English middle class. A proponent of self-improvement, he also wrote practical guides on success and mental efficiency, blending literary skill with pragmatic wisdom.
